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Beaufont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Beaufont with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Beaufont is at Chippenham Townhomes listed at $1,200.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Beaufont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Beaufont is $1,655.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Beaufont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Beaufont is a 1,245 square feet unit starting from $2,662 at The James at Springline.

What is the average size for Beaufont 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Beaufont is currently 957 sq ft.
